How to Monetize Your Blog and Earn Passive Income

Blogging has become more than just a platform to share ideas and stories; it’s a lucrative way to earn passive income. But how exactly can you turn your blog into a money-making machine? Whether you're a beginner or looking to expand your monetization strategies, this guide covers everything you need to know.

Importance of Blog Monetization

A monetized blog not only rewards your efforts but also builds financial security. The best part is that once the groundwork is laid, it generates income with minimal effort—true passive income.

Overview of Passive Income Strategies

Passive income through blogging can come in various forms: affiliate marketing, selling digital products, and more. These strategies require initial effort but pay off long-term when executed effectively.

Choosing the Right Niche

What Makes a Niche Profitable?

The foundation of a successful blog lies in choosing the right niche. A profitable niche should have high demand, passionate audiences, and clear monetization opportunities. Popular niches include personal finance, health and wellness, and tech.

Examples of High-Performing Niches

Some top-performing niches are:

  • Personal Finance: Includes budgeting, investing, and saving tips.
  • Lifestyle: Encompasses fashion, travel, and home improvement.
  • Tech Reviews: Offers insights into gadgets, apps, and software.

Creating Quality Content

Why Quality Content Attracts Traffic

Content is king! High-quality posts attract and retain readers, encouraging them to return and engage with your blog. Always aim to solve a problem or provide value in your niche.

Content Consistency and Scheduling Tips

A consistent publishing schedule builds trust. Use content calendars to plan posts in advance and maintain a steady flow of updates to keep your audience hooked.

Building an Engaged Audience

Using Social Media to Grow Your Audience

Social media platforms are invaluable tools for reaching a larger audience. Platforms like Instagram, Twitter, and Pinterest allow bloggers to share content and engage with followers directly.

Importance of Email Lists

Email marketing is one of the most reliable ways to connect with your audience. Offer free lead magnets like e-books to encourage subscriptions and build a loyal reader base.

Affiliate Marketing

How Affiliate Marketing Works

Affiliate marketing involves promoting products and earning a commission for every sale through your referral links. It’s a win-win: you help your audience find useful products while earning income.

Selecting the Best Affiliate Programs for Your Blog

Choose programs aligned with your niche. For example:

  • Tech bloggers: Amazon Associates for gadgets.
  • Lifestyle bloggers: RewardStyle for fashion.

Display Advertising

How to Set Up Display Ads on Your Blog

Display ads are easy to set up using platforms like Google AdSense. Once approved, you can place ads on high-traffic pages for steady income.

Comparing Ad Networks: Google AdSense vs. Others

While AdSense is popular, consider alternatives like Mediavine or AdThrive, which offer higher revenue for niche blogs with substantial traffic.

Sponsored Content and Partnerships

Pitching to Brands for Sponsorship

Collaborating with brands can be lucrative. Create a media kit showcasing your blog’s reach and value to attract potential sponsors.

Types of Sponsored Content That Work

Options include product reviews, sponsored posts, and giveaways. Ensure the content aligns with your audience’s interests to maintain credibility.

Selling Digital Products

Best Digital Products to Sell on Your Blog

Selling digital products is a high-margin strategy. Popular options include:

  • E-books: Write about your niche expertise.
  • Templates: Useful for design, budgeting, or project planning.
  • Courses: Share skills or knowledge in a structured format.

Tools for Creating Digital Products

Tools like Canva for designing, Teachable for hosting courses, and Gumroad for selling products can simplify the process of creating and monetizing digital assets.

Membership Programs and Subscriptions

Setting Up a Membership Area

Membership programs provide exclusive content for paying subscribers. Platforms like Patreon or MemberPress make it easy to manage subscriptions and access levels.

Benefits of Recurring Revenue

Recurring revenue ensures a steady income stream. Members are more likely to stay engaged, knowing they have access to unique, valuable content.

SEO Best Practices for Monetization

Keyword Research for Profitability

Effective SEO starts with keyword research.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to identify high-volume, low-competition keywords that match your audience’s needs.

Optimizing Blog Posts for Search Engines

Optimize every post by including keywords in titles, headers, and meta descriptions. Also, focus on mobile-friendly layouts and fast loading speeds to improve rankings.

Leveraging Analytics

Using Google Analytics to Monitor Success

Google Analytics helps track your blog’s performance. Key metrics to monitor include traffic sources, bounce rates, and conversion rates.

How to Optimize Underperforming Content

Identify underperforming posts and update them with fresh keywords, visuals, or data. Republishing improved content can significantly boost traffic and revenue.

Improving User Experience (UX)

Website Speed and Mobile Responsiveness

A slow website drives visitors away. Use tools like GTmetrix to analyze and improve your blog’s speed. Mobile responsiveness is equally critical as most users browse via smartphones.

Importance of Easy Navigation

Clear menus and search functions help readers find content quickly. Simplified navigation enhances user experience and encourages longer visits.

Offering Online Courses

How to Create an Online Course

Creating a course begins with identifying a topic that resonates with your audience. Use platforms like Teachable or Udemy to design and deliver your course content. Break down complex topics into easy-to-follow modules with supporting materials like PDFs and videos.

Popular Course Topics for Bloggers

Successful courses often cover:

  • Skill Development: Photography, writing, or graphic design.
  • Niche Expertise: Fitness routines, cooking, or DIY crafts.
  • Professional Growth: Marketing, SEO, or coding tutorials.

Creating a YouTube Channel for Your Blog

Linking YouTube Content with Blog Posts

A YouTube channel complements your blog by reaching a broader audience. Create videos based on your blog posts, adding links back to your website for increased traffic and conversions.

Monetizing YouTube Videos

Monetize YouTube through ads, sponsored content, and memberships. To qualify for YouTube’s Partner Program, aim to build a channel with at least 1,000 subscribers and 4,000 watch hours within 12 months.

Hosting Webinars

How Webinars Can Drive Income

Webinars are interactive and engaging. They can be used to promote paid courses, offer exclusive insights, or sell digital products. Their live format builds trust and drives sales effectively.

Tools for Hosting Successful Webinars

Platforms like Zoom, GoToWebinar, and WebinarJam simplify the process of hosting, promoting, and recording webinars for future monetization opportunities.

Licensing Your Content

Selling the Rights to Your Content

If you’ve created unique, high-quality content, you can license it to other blogs, websites, or media outlets. This works well for infographics, e-books, or articles.

Examples of Licensing Deals

A travel blogger could license destination guides to tourism companies, or a tech blogger might sell reviews to gadget manufacturers. Licensing ensures recurring income with minimal effort.

Outsourcing Tasks

Hiring Virtual Assistants and Freelancers

As your blog grows, managing everything on your own can become overwhelming. Outsourcing tasks like content writing, social media management, or email marketing frees up your time to focus on revenue-generating activities.

Tasks to Delegate for Maximum Efficiency

Common tasks to delegate include:

  • Editing and proofreading
  • Graphic design
  • Website maintenance

Diversifying Revenue Streams

Why You Shouldn't Rely on One Income Source

Depending solely on one revenue stream can be risky. Changes in algorithms, ad policies, or market trends can impact your income. Diversifying your income sources ensures stability and long-term growth.

How to Add New Revenue Streams

To diversify:

  1. Combine affiliate marketing with digital product sales.
  2. Experiment with sponsored content and memberships.
  3. Explore new platforms like podcasts or newsletters to expand reach and revenue.

Scaling Through Partnerships

Collaboration with Other Bloggers

Partnering with bloggers in your niche can boost visibility. Guest posting, co-hosting webinars, or cross-promoting content are excellent ways to grow your audience and income.

Joint Ventures That Work

Joint ventures like launching a course together or hosting a collaborative challenge can attract both audiences and create shared revenue opportunities.

Reinvesting for Growth

How to Use Profits to Grow Your Blog

Reinvesting earnings into your blog accelerates growth. For instance:

  • Upgrade hosting for better performance.
  • Use paid tools like premium SEO software.
  • Invest in professional branding or photography.

Tools Worth Investing In

Top tools for reinvestment include:

  • SEMrush: Advanced SEO insights.
  • ConvertKit: Email marketing automation.
  • Canva Pro: High-quality graphic design templates.

Staying Updated on Industry Trends

Keeping Up with Blogging and Marketing Trends

Blogging is an ever-evolving field. Stay informed about changes in SEO, social media algorithms, and monetization strategies to remain competitive.

Resources to Stay Ahead

Follow industry blogs, attend webinars, and participate in forums to gain insights. Subscribe to newsletters like Neil Patel’s or HubSpot’s for regular updates.

FAQs

1. What is the fastest way to monetize a blog?

Affiliate marketing is often the quickest way to start earning money. You can promote products and earn commissions as soon as you generate traffic.

2. How long does it take to start earning passive income from a blog?

It depends on your niche and strategy, but most bloggers start seeing results within 6-12 months of consistent effort.

3. Do I need a large audience to make money blogging?

Not necessarily. A small but engaged audience can be highly profitable if you use targeted monetization strategies like selling digital products or memberships.

4. What tools do I need to monetize my blog?

Essential tools include:

  • SEO software like SEMrush or Ahrefs.
  • Email marketing platforms like ConvertKit.
  • Ad networks like Google AdSense.

5. Can I monetize a free blog platform?

While possible, free platforms have limitations. Owning a self-hosted blog gives you more control and flexibility to implement advanced monetization strategies.
